STM32F4 + FSMC

Добавлено: Пт июн 28, 2013 10:24:18
osievskiy

Код: Выделить всё


#include "stm32f4_discovery.h"
#include "stm32f4xx_fsmc.h"


int main(void)
{

	SystemInit();

	
	
	GPIO_InitTypeDef GPIO_InitStructure;

	/* Enable GPIO D and E clocks */
	RCC_AHB1PeriphClockCmd(
			RCC_AHB1Periph_GPIOB | RCC_AHB1Periph_GPIOD | RCC_AHB1Periph_GPIOE,
			ENABLE);

	// Create GPIO D Init structure for used pins
	GPIO_InitStructure.GPIO_Pin = GPIO_Pin_4 | GPIO_Pin_5 | GPIO_Pin_7
			| GPIO_Pin_8 | GPIO_Pin_9 | GPIO_Pin_10 | GPIO_Pin_11;
	GPIO_InitStructure.GPIO_Mode = GPIO_Mode_AF;
	GPIO_InitStructure.GPIO_Speed = GPIO_Speed_100MHz;
	GPIO_InitStructure.GPIO_OType = GPIO_OType_PP;
	GPIO_InitStructure.GPIO_PuPd = GPIO_PuPd_UP;

	/* Initialize pins */
	GPIO_Init(GPIOD, &GPIO_InitStructure);

	/* Configure GPIO D pins as FSMC alternate functions */
	GPIO_PinAFConfig(GPIOD, GPIO_PinSource4, GPIO_AF_FSMC); // NOE -> RD
	GPIO_PinAFConfig(GPIOD, GPIO_PinSource5, GPIO_AF_FSMC); // NWE -> WR
	GPIO_PinAFConfig(GPIOD, GPIO_PinSource7, GPIO_AF_FSMC); // NE1 -> CS
	GPIO_PinAFConfig(GPIOD, GPIO_PinSource8, GPIO_AF_FSMC); // D13 -> D5
	GPIO_PinAFConfig(GPIOD, GPIO_PinSource9, GPIO_AF_FSMC); // D14 -> D6
	GPIO_PinAFConfig(GPIOD, GPIO_PinSource10, GPIO_AF_FSMC); // D15 -> D7
	GPIO_PinAFConfig(GPIOD, GPIO_PinSource11, GPIO_AF_FSMC); // A16 -> RS

	/* Create GPIO E Init structure for used pin */
	GPIO_InitStructure.GPIO_Pin = GPIO_Pin_11 | GPIO_Pin_12 | GPIO_Pin_13
			| GPIO_Pin_14 | GPIO_Pin_15;
	GPIO_InitStructure.GPIO_Mode = GPIO_Mode_AF;
	GPIO_InitStructure.GPIO_Speed = GPIO_Speed_100MHz;
	GPIO_InitStructure.GPIO_OType = GPIO_OType_PP;
	GPIO_InitStructure.GPIO_PuPd = GPIO_PuPd_UP;

	/* Initialize GPIOE pins */
	GPIO_Init(GPIOE, &GPIO_InitStructure);

	/* Configure GPIO E pins as FSMC alternate functions */
	GPIO_PinAFConfig(GPIOE, GPIO_PinSource11, GPIO_AF_FSMC); // D8  -> D0
	GPIO_PinAFConfig(GPIOE, GPIO_PinSource12, GPIO_AF_FSMC); // D9  -> D1
	GPIO_PinAFConfig(GPIOE, GPIO_PinSource13, GPIO_AF_FSMC); // D10 -> D2
	GPIO_PinAFConfig(GPIOE, GPIO_PinSource14, GPIO_AF_FSMC); // D11 -> D3
	GPIO_PinAFConfig(GPIOE, GPIO_PinSource15, GPIO_AF_FSMC); // D12 -> D4

	/* Configure Reset Pin */
	GPIO_InitStructure.GPIO_Pin = GPIO_Pin_10;
	GPIO_InitStructure.GPIO_Mode = GPIO_Mode_OUT;
	GPIO_InitStructure.GPIO_Speed = GPIO_Speed_100MHz;
	GPIO_InitStructure.GPIO_OType = GPIO_OType_PP;
	GPIO_InitStructure.GPIO_PuPd = GPIO_PuPd_UP;

	/* Initialize GPIOE pins */
	GPIO_Init(GPIOE, &GPIO_InitStructure);
	
	
	FSMC_NORSRAMInitTypeDef FSMC_NORSRAMInitStructure;
	FSMC_NORSRAMTimingInitTypeDef FSMC_NORSRAMTimingInitStructureRead;
	FSMC_NORSRAMTimingInitTypeDef FSMC_NORSRAMTimingInitStructureWrite;

	/* Enable FSMC Clock */
	RCC_AHB3PeriphClockCmd(RCC_AHB3Periph_FSMC, ENABLE);

	/* Define Read timing parameters */
	FSMC_NORSRAMTimingInitStructureRead.FSMC_AddressSetupTime = 3;
	FSMC_NORSRAMTimingInitStructureRead.FSMC_AddressHoldTime = 0;
	FSMC_NORSRAMTimingInitStructureRead.FSMC_DataSetupTime = 15;
	FSMC_NORSRAMTimingInitStructureRead.FSMC_BusTurnAroundDuration = 0;
	FSMC_NORSRAMTimingInitStructureRead.FSMC_CLKDivision = 1;
	FSMC_NORSRAMTimingInitStructureRead.FSMC_DataLatency = 0;
	FSMC_NORSRAMTimingInitStructureRead.FSMC_AccessMode = FSMC_AccessMode_A;

	/* Define Write Timing parameters */
	FSMC_NORSRAMTimingInitStructureWrite.FSMC_AddressSetupTime = 3;
	FSMC_NORSRAMTimingInitStructureWrite.FSMC_AddressHoldTime = 0;
	FSMC_NORSRAMTimingInitStructureWrite.FSMC_DataSetupTime = 6;
	FSMC_NORSRAMTimingInitStructureWrite.FSMC_BusTurnAroundDuration = 0;
	FSMC_NORSRAMTimingInitStructureWrite.FSMC_CLKDivision = 1;
	FSMC_NORSRAMTimingInitStructureWrite.FSMC_DataLatency = 0;
	FSMC_NORSRAMTimingInitStructureWrite.FSMC_AccessMode = FSMC_AccessMode_A;

	/* Define protocol type */
	FSMC_NORSRAMInitStructure.FSMC_Bank = FSMC_Bank1_NORSRAM1; //Bank1
	FSMC_NORSRAMInitStructure.FSMC_DataAddressMux = FSMC_DataAddressMux_Disable; //No mux
	FSMC_NORSRAMInitStructure.FSMC_MemoryType = FSMC_MemoryType_SRAM; //SRAM type
	FSMC_NORSRAMInitStructure.FSMC_MemoryDataWidth = FSMC_MemoryDataWidth_16b; //16 bits wide
	FSMC_NORSRAMInitStructure.FSMC_BurstAccessMode =
			FSMC_BurstAccessMode_Disable; //No Burst
	FSMC_NORSRAMInitStructure.FSMC_AsynchronousWait =
			FSMC_AsynchronousWait_Disable; // No wait
	FSMC_NORSRAMInitStructure.FSMC_WaitSignalPolarity =
			FSMC_WaitSignalPolarity_Low; //Don'tcare
	FSMC_NORSRAMInitStructure.FSMC_WrapMode = FSMC_WrapMode_Disable; //No wrap mode
	FSMC_NORSRAMInitStructure.FSMC_WaitSignalActive =
			FSMC_WaitSignalActive_BeforeWaitState; //Don't care
	FSMC_NORSRAMInitStructure.FSMC_WriteOperation = FSMC_WriteOperation_Enable;
	FSMC_NORSRAMInitStructure.FSMC_WaitSignal = FSMC_WaitSignal_Disable; //Don't care
	FSMC_NORSRAMInitStructure.FSMC_ExtendedMode = FSMC_ExtendedMode_Enable; //Allow distinct Read/Write parameters
	FSMC_NORSRAMInitStructure.FSMC_WriteBurst = FSMC_WriteBurst_Disable; //Don't care

	// Set read timing structure
	FSMC_NORSRAMInitStructure.FSMC_ReadWriteTimingStruct =
			&FSMC_NORSRAMTimingInitStructureRead;

	// Set write timing structure
	FSMC_NORSRAMInitStructure.FSMC_WriteTimingStruct =
			&FSMC_NORSRAMTimingInitStructureWrite;

	// Initialize FSMC for read and write
	FSMC_NORSRAMInit(&FSMC_NORSRAMInitStructure);

	// Enable FSMC
	FSMC_NORSRAMCmd(FSMC_Bank1_NORSRAM1, ENABLE);
	

	

  while (1)
  {
		 
  }
}

Добрый день.
Почему вылазит при компиляции ошибки?

.\Exti\Exti.axf: Error: L6218E: Undefined symbol FSMC_NORSRAMCmd (referred from main.o).
.\Exti\Exti.axf: Error: L6218E: Undefined symbol FSMC_NORSRAMInit (referred from main.o).

Re: STM32F4 + FSMC

Добавлено: Пт июн 28, 2013 10:47:16
k000858
osievskiy писал(а): Добрый день.
Почему вылазит при компиляции ошибки?

.\Exti\Exti.axf: Error: L6218E: Undefined symbol FSMC_NORSRAMCmd (referred from main.o).
.\Exti\Exti.axf: Error: L6218E: Undefined symbol FSMC_NORSRAMInit (referred from main.o).
"stm32f4xx_fsmc.с подключен в проект?
